Writing in Bike Radar, Jenn Hopkins from Mountain Biking UK passes out the Caffélatex love, giving Effetto Mariposa's "novel and effective tyre goop" 4.5 stars, saying,
If you’re running tubeless tyres, then you're probably using sealant. Caffelatex is an ammonia-free synthetic latex tyre goop with an added foaming agent. Riding causes bubbles to build up, eventually filling the tyre cavity and helping the liquid coat the inside of the tyre more effectively than standard thin latex.
This means better sealing for small sidewall cuts and scuffs, as well as simpler and quicker initial set-up.
